Output efb698cb3dfbe7365aa5165251cd6c222d27e9df555344b8fd6100cfd364f8ae:1

value
8643287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3705303e4a5b7572558f37ac08d6a66d63cacbb OP_EQUAL
address
3Ly14Sv7U5fb2wir9hhDo8xk3QS8fDwkYa
transaction
efb698cb3dfbe7365aa5165251cd6c222d27e9df555344b8fd6100cfd364f8ae
spent
true